Choosing to not vaccinate your child is like choosing to drive drunk. Because not vaccinating your child also will exposed other kids to theses preventable diseases. Just like driving drunk, you are imposing huge risk to the public. You and your family do not live on an island.
For babies that are too young to receive certain vaccinations, like the measles/mumps/rubella/chicken pox, these babies are depending on other kids to protect them from these diseases until they are old enough to get those vaccinations (>1 year).
